如何在PWA Android应用中隐藏URL栏?

时间:2019-06-05 02:45:35

标签: android progressive-web-apps trusted-web-activity

我正在按照所有步骤将我的PWA转换为Android应用,但它无法显示URL栏

我已经建立了我的PWA 我已经与Lighthouse核对,并获得+90的分数 我把它变成本地的 我已经获得SHA256应用签名证书 我已经使用数字资产链接工具检查了我的assetlinks.json。 我已经在Google Play上发布了

但是我的应用程序顶部仍然有网址栏

assetlinks.json

some user agent/1.3     KnownString1_324-56-00998
user/agent              KnownString1_123-345-4534
User/Agent cURL/1.5.0   KnownString2_123456
one/User Agent/2.0      KnownString1_123_456_78

AndroidManifest.xml

[{
  "relation": ["delegate_permission/common.handle_all_urls"],
  "target" : { "namespace": "android_app", "package_name":     "org.mysite.mysite",
               "sha256_cert_fingerprints": ["..."] }
}]

2 个答案:

答案 0 :(得分:0)

要隐藏地址栏并获得PWA的全屏视图,您需要在PWA的manifest.json文件中拥有"display": "standalone"属性。

答案 1 :(得分:0)

嘿,我想如果您将它存储在Play商店中,则必须将其包装在一个骨架化的android应用中?这些称为TWA或受信任的Web应用程序。您可以尝试隐藏状态栏

<style>
<item name="android:windowActionBar">false</item>
</style>

如果这不起作用,请尝试